shooting_nighttime.jpgA man believed to be 20 years old was shot in the leg when two male suspects confronted him in San Francisco’s Mission District early this morning, San Francisco police said.

The 20-year-old was walking near 15th and Capp streets around 2 a.m., police said, when he was approached by two males dressed in all black who asked him if he was in a gang.

The victim said he was not affiliated with any gangs, after which the suspects shot him in the leg and fled the scene before police arrived, police said.

The victim was treated at the scene and then taken to the hospital in stable condition, police said.

The suspects were only described as Hispanic males wearing all black clothing, according to police.
